This job is primarily responsible for working at a facility that loads and unloads barges and trucks. This is a general laborer position that performs a wide variety of duties that are based on the daily needs of the operation; may include cleaning and repair of barges.

In this job, you will:

Actual responsibilities will vary depending on daily needs and type of facility.

  • Fully participate in the company Safety Program and attends daily pre-shift meetings.
  • Perform all duties within compliance of OSHA, company safety, and environmental regulations (ISO where applicable); including wearing appropriate PPE for task being performed.
  • Perform deckhand responsibilities e.g., reading drafts, opening/closing lids, tying off barges, etc.
  • Perform all barge loading duties e.g., loading barges to meet draft and quality requirements and oversees deckhand(s). Note: Generally the duty of the most highly qualified person(s).
  • Perform duties to transfer, load and move grain to appropriate location, where applicable.
  • Perform duties required to maintain grain quality while being stored and/or transferred.
  • Complete documentation timely, accurately and legibly.
  • Perform general clean-up including sweeping, shoveling, washing, painting and other general housekeeping responsibilities.
  • Perform preventative maintenance and/or repairs, where applicable.
  • Dependent on facility and location, may be responsible for any variety of the following; unloading barges, cleaning barges, movement of product to storage, loading of trucks using heavy equipment, loading of rail, loading of products to required specifications; operating, running, monitoring, and shutting down dryer; operating a variety of heavy equipment.
  • Other duties as assigned.
